Temperature-dependence of desensitization induced by acetylcholine and histamine in guinea-pig ileal longitudinal muscle.

Abstract
  1. The effects of temperature on the time course of desensitization induced by acetylcholine and histamine, and on the recovery from desensitization were studied in the longitudinal muscle of the guinea-pig ileum. 2. Self- and cross-desensitization produced by acetylcholine (10(-5) M) occurred rapidly in the first 10 min of exposure to the agonist, with the same time course and the same degree of desensitization over the temperature range of 11 degrees C to 31 degrees C. 3. Self-desensitization produced by histamine (10(-5) M) also occurred rapidly in the first 10 min of exposure to the agonist, and showed great temperature-dependence, especially at 11 degrees C and 21 degrees C, but scarcely occurred at 6 degrees C. 4. Cross-desensitization produced by histamine developed gradually with time and showed a moderate temperature-dependence between 11 degrees C and 31 degrees C, but scarcely occurred at 6 degrees C. 5. The recovery processes from desensitization showed marked temperature-dependence. Recovery was halted completely at 11 degrees C. 6. These studies suggest that acetylcholine-induced desensitization may be attributed to a single non-specific mechanism. Histamine-induced desensitization may be due to at least two mechanisms: it occurs in both a specific and non-specific manner. Each of these desensitizations can be characterized by its unique temperature-dependence.
摘要
  1. 研究了温度对豚鼠回肠纵行肌中乙酰胆碱和组胺诱导脱敏的时间进程以及脱敏恢复的影响。2. 乙酰胆碱(10⁻⁵ M)引起的自身脱敏和交叉脱敏在暴露于激动剂的最初10分钟内迅速发生,在11℃至31℃的温度范围内,具有相同的时间进程和脱敏程度。3. 组胺(10⁻⁵ M)引起的自身脱敏在暴露于激动剂的最初10分钟内也迅速发生,并且表现出很大的温度依赖性,尤其是在11℃和21℃时,但在6℃时几乎不发生。4. 组胺引起的交叉脱敏随时间逐渐发展,在11℃至31℃之间表现出适度的温度依赖性,但在6℃时几乎不发生。5. 脱敏后的恢复过程表现出明显的温度依赖性。在11℃时恢复完全停止。6. 这些研究表明,乙酰胆碱诱导的脱敏可能归因于单一的非特异性机制。组胺诱导的脱敏可能至少归因于两种机制:它以特异性和非特异性两种方式发生。每种脱敏都可以通过其独特的温度依赖性来表征。
